Transaction 43398479ab32f3aa04377e18a0a426a8e38d75d561ead3f7ba8c14e1c3e834a3
1 Input
1 Output
-
43398479ab32f3aa04377e18a0a426a8e38d75d561ead3f7ba8c14e1c3e834a3:0
- value
- 740554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a4ce1130bd615ca3e709c1bb14be0583684747d OP_EQUAL
- address
- 3EJHGgCKfBZXpViPXhKmPCb1pNAYjXZq4r